Why the Japanese Cat Litter Box Market Is Booming in 2025

Japan’s pet market is experiencing a quiet but powerful boom—and cats are right at the heart of it.

According to economist Miyamoto Katsuhiro, cat-related spending is expected to reach ¥2.9 trillion (≈$19.6 billion) by 2025, driven by social shifts and changing consumer values.

What’s fueling this growth?

  • An aging population that prefers the lower-maintenance companionship of cats

  • Urban lifestyles with limited space, making compact pet products essential

  • The ongoing rise of pet “humanization,” where owners seek both practical function and elegant, home-friendly design

Minimalist Japanese interior with a smart Japanese cat litter box and a white cat playing on a tatami mat.

Data from WorldPopulationReview shows there are now 7.3 million cats and 12 million dogs in Japan—yet when it comes to spending trends, cats are leading in innovation and product personalization.

On major e-commerce platforms like Rakuten, Amazon Japan, and Nitori, searches for terms such as:

  • “quiet litter box”
  • “compact cat toilet”
  • “odor-free cat toilet”

are not only popular—they’re shaping product development in 2025.

What Makes a Japanese Cat Litter Box Truly Different?

A Japanese cat litter box isn’t just about function—it’s about form, harmony, and how seamlessly it fits into daily life. For Japanese consumers, especially those living in compact apartments, a litter box must do more than serve its purpose—it has to quietly blend into the space without disrupting it.

Here’s what sets Japanese-style litter boxes apart:

  • Minimalist color palettes – Soft tones like beige, ivory, and light gray are preferred to match neutral, calming interiors.

  • Compact dimensions – Most products fall between 42–50 cm in width, optimized to fit small rooms, narrow hallways, or under counters.

  • Noise-reduction focus – Especially for automatic models, whisper-quiet operation is a must. Loud motors or disruptive movement can be dealbreakers in quiet homes.

  • Strong odor control – Dual-lid systems, activated charcoal filters, and antibacterial materials are common to keep homes smelling fresh and clean.

For many Japanese buyers, the ideal cat litter box doesn’t scream “pet product.” It’s discreet, efficient, and thoughtfully designed to complement a curated home environment.

Exporting Japanese Cat Litter Box to Japan: A Step-by-Step Overview

Planning to export your Japanese cat litter box design from China to Japan? You’re on the right track—but as with any international trade, the details matter.

From labeling and packaging to customs documentation and HS codes, ensuring compliance isn’t just about ticking boxes—it’s about keeping your shipments smooth, your brand reputation strong, and your go-to-market plan on time.

Here’s a simplified breakdown of what you’ll need to manage:

1. Shipping & Logistics

  • Air freight is great for small sample shipments or time-sensitive launches
  • Sea freight (LCL or FCL) is more cost-effective for bulk production runs

2. Labeling Requirements (for Japan market)

  • Product manuals or instructions must be in Japanese, ideally with clean, readable formatting
  • Include mandatory safety icons and use indicators according to JIS (Japanese Industrial Standards)

3. Tariffs & Customs Clearance

  • Use HS Code: 3924.90.00 (Plastic sanitary articles)
  • Import duty typically ranges from 3.4%–5% depending on product type and declared value

Required documentation includes:

  • Commercial Invoice
  • Certificate of Origin
  • Packing List
  • MSDS (if applicable to materials used)

FAQs About Japanese Cat Litter Box Design, Customization & Export

1. What’s the ideal size for a Japanese cat litter box?

Most Japanese homes prioritize space efficiency, so the ideal size typically ranges between 42–50 cm in length. This keeps the product compact enough for smaller apartments while still providing a comfortable and natural experience for the cat.

2. Can we use antibacterial or antimicrobial materials in production?

Absolutely. Many Japanese consumers value hygiene-focused design. We offer materials such as antibacterial ABS with silver-ion additives and antimicrobial-grade polypropylene (PP) to meet both performance and market expectations.

3. How long does it take to create a custom mold for our litter box design?

On average, mold creation takes about 15–20 working days, depending on the complexity of your design and the level of precision required. We’ll guide you through the design-for-manufacture (DFM) process to ensure the result meets both functional and aesthetic goals.

4. Will the packaging and labeling include Japanese text?

Yes. We provide full Japanese labeling and compliance support, including layout translation, font adjustments, and iconography aligned with local retail and regulatory standards—whether you’re selling online or in physical stores.
